Parking charges are rejected
Councillor leader Jim McCabe made the announcement
CONTROVERSIAL proposals to introduce charges at all North Lanarkshire Council owned car parks have been knocked back.
The plans, which were widely criticised, would have introduced a fee for the use of local park and rides, and car parks in Kilsyth.
And the dramatic news, announced by council leader Jim McCabe, was widely welcomed.
